Fast Fairmount Park Facts
- A system of 9,200 acres of parks
- Over 10% of the land in Philadelphia
- 5,600 acres of natural areas (e.g. woodlands, wetlands, meadows)
- 63 neighborhood and regional parks
- Logan, Franklin, Washington, and Rittenhouse Squares are all included in the Fairmount Park system
- The largest collection of historic properties in Pennsylvania
- Over 215 miles of recreational trails
- 22 playgrounds, 127 tennis courts, 35 basketball courts, and 160 baseball, football, soccer and softball fields
- More than 85 Park Friends groups and 90,000 volunteers working to support the Park
- The 130-year-old Fairmount Park Rowing Association provides facilities for Masters, Juniors and Elite rowing programs and also houses the Le Salle University and Episcopal Academy crew teams
- The Fairmount Park Ranger Corps not only enforces rules in the park system, but also provides emergency services and park education
- West Fairmount Park's Solitude, on the grounds of the Philadelphia Zoo, was home to William Penn's grandson, John Penn - be sure to check out the secret basement tunnel
